How are a persuasive essay and an expository essay different?

In a persuasive essay, the writer tries to convince the reader to agree with the point of view presented, while in an expository essay, the writer describes and explains all sides of a topic or issue

in of mice and men What information do we get about George and Lennie’s childhood in Chapter 3? How does this help us understand
Alchen [17]

George and Lennie have been associated from a long time, and that their bond symbolizes respect, care and concern over each other.

Explanation:

As we start reading Chapter 3, readers now understand the basic outline of the characters. George and Slim comeback to bunk house, sit down to relax while they start talking about Slim giving his puppy to Lennie. This is the time where George starts sharing his memories/experiences that he has had with Lennie to Slim.

The incident where George played a prank asking Lennie to jump into the river where they were hanging out. Lennie jumped into the water without thinking twice about not being able to swim, only because George ordered him to do so was a thought-provoking memory for George. Since then, George never played any prank against Lennie's innocence but has lot of fun with him.He understood how pure Lennie is. He shares with Slim that he enjoys Lennie's company and that they also became bullies many times and came out of those bad times together.

This depicts the depth of understanding each other and the bond they share.
